I recently just bought the headblade ; it's probably the worst razor I've shaved my head with. I put no pressure on it what so ever to the point where it was almost floating above my head ; it still cut the crap out of my head.

Before that I was using the Mach 3 which is great. I get a lot of razor burn from shaving against the grain ; but it's the only way I can get a close enough shave. That's a lot better than cuts and rash. I'm throwing this thing away.

I really want to get an electric shaver for my head though ; the mach 3 is great but the blades go so fast.

Sorry you had a bad experience with the Headblade. Like a lot of SBG's here, I'm a loyal HB Guy. It can be awkward at first, but I wouldn't give up on it after on use. Clearly, a lot of people swear by it. Rather than letting it "float" over the head, the key is making sure the back of the razor (the wheels on the "Sport" model and the little plastic nub on the "Classic") remains in contact with your skin. The angle of the razor is positioned such that when the back of the razor is touching your head, the shave is pretty easy. It's just like combing your hair from front to back. Plus, the quality of the shave is top notch!

Bottom line, being SLY is top priority. How you get there is entirely up to you. But, before you ditch the HB, consider the above. Also, HB's website has a "How To" video on using the HB. Check it out.
